    SUMMARY:

    The Employment and Training Administration published a document in the Federal Register on March 25, 2005, concerning the availability of grant funds for eligible “grassroots” organizations with the ability to connect to the local One-Stop Delivery System. This correction is to provide additional clarification on eligibility information.

    Corrections

    In the Federal Register of March 25, 2005, in FR Volume 70, Number 57:

    —On page 15354, in the third column, III Eligibility Information, 1. Eligible Applicants is hereby edited to include the following:

    • Current or past grantees eligibility—Those grassroots grantees who were awarded grants as a result of the 2004 DOL solicitation are not eligible to apply. However, previous grassroots grantees are eligible.
    • Affiliate of a national organization—An applicant may be an affiliate of a national organization, although to be eligible, an applicant must demonstrate that it meets the eligibility requirements in this SGA. Also please keep in mind the intent of this solicitation is to broaden the participation of small organizations in the nation's workforce development system.
